How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 94617?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 94617 Studio Apartments | $2,498 | $895 | $8,976 |
| 94617 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,081 | $286 | $6,919 |
| 94617 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,064 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| 94617 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,745 | $2,095 | $18,482 |
| 94617 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,944 | $1,000 | $7,257 |
| 94617 5 Bedroom Apartments | $10,093 | $4,000 | $15,289 |
